2. Mushroom Brown
Earthy and ashy is the name of the game when it comes to achieving the perfect Mushroom Brown. Equal parts cool and natural, this hue starts with an ashy brown base with hints of taupe and gray. It falls somewhere between blonde and brunette, making it ideal for clients who want something trendy, but muted.
3. Strawberry Brown Balayage
We will never know if blondes truly have more fun…but Strawberry Brown balayage might be the most fun hue to do. Using balayage for this trend helps the Strawberry Brown look more lived in and natural. Keep roots a bit darker, and hand paint copper/red hues throughout your client’s hair. The end result should look sun-drenched and full of depth.

5. Honey Blonde
This timeless, warm shade isn’t going anywhere anytime soon! Combining rich gold and caramel tones, this is a softer, warmer blonde that clients will continue to ask for this year. It’s also a great option for brunettes who want to add a little lightness to their locks! Honey blonde should complement your client’s natural glow, so lean into their skin tone to choose the right hue.
Pro tip: try honey blonde highlights with a dark root shadow for extra dimension!
